Box Score NORTHFIELD, Vt. – The Castleton men's tennis team traveled in-state to take on Norwich University Wednesday afternoon, winning a doubles match and singles match before ultimately falling 7-2 to the Cadets.
The Spartans (0-2) dropped the afternoon's first two doubles matches 8-6 and 8-3 before
Miguel Almirall Perez and
Jahwara Rennalls earned Castleton their first win of the day, besting Norwich's Patrick O'Neal and Isaac Chapman 8-6 in No. 3 doubles.
On the singles side,
Jason Lipscomb and
Rowan Kidder fell in straight sets at No.1 and No. 3 singles before Rennalls earned the first singles win of his career, topping the Cadets' Molly Twombly 6-3, 6-2. Norwich (1-0) sealed the team victory, however, with wins over the Spartans'
Phil Kluge and Almirall Perez at No. 2 and No. 5 singles to go up 6-2.
The day concluded with freshman
Dante Buttino falling in straight sets to Norwich's Dimitry Mucha at No. 4 singles, handing Castleton the 7-2 loss.
The Spartans are back in action Saturday, March 19 to take on NVU-Lyndon, with the opening match set for 1 p.m.
